South Africa's President Attends Regional Summit

President Jacob Zuma is attending a two-day extraordinary summit of the Southern African Development Community, where pressing peace and security matters such as the crisis in the Democratic Republic of Congo and the situations in Zimbabwe and Madagascar are to be discussed.
